Anya Taylor-Joy
Anya Taylor Joy (born April 16th, 1996) was born in Miami Florida. Dennis Alan Taylor was a former banker. Jennifer Marina Joy worked as a psychotherapist. The father of her is Argentine of Scottish and English descendance. Her mother's ancestry is Spanish as well as English. She was the first born of a household of six children. Four of her siblings are from her previous marriage to Taylor's father. The family was within Buenos Aires until she was six years old, and then moved to the Victoria region of London. Taylor-Joy claims that the move to London was traumatic and she did not learn English in order to prevent returning to Argentina. Hill House, a school within the same district as Northlands was required to take her. Later, she enrolled in Queen's Gate School to study ballet and act in productions of the school. After she turned 16, Taylor-Joy dropped out to focus her full-time acting career. Taylor-Joy was always aware of her desire to be an actor. Her dream was granted a chance by Sarah Doukas founder of Storm Management, who offered her the opportunity to model.
